Is this a head gasket issue?

2002 HONDA CRV
127,000 MILES

I am losing coolant with no apparent leaks, about 1 liter per week. Pressure test does not show leakage, cap has been changed. Cold start is difficult like it is running on 2-3 cylinders. It will idle normally after playing with the gas for a few minutes. A lot of white smoke will be seen but will dissapear after a few minutes of driving. There is no apparent oil loss and the oil is clean not cloudy, likewise with the transmission. What could this be?

Sounds typical of a leaking head gasket. You might have luck adding a small bottle of dye to the coolant, then after a day or two, search with a black light, particularly at the tail pipe. The dye will show up as a bright yellow stain. Many auto parts stores will sell you the dye and rent or borrow the black light.
